Abstract
The study investigates the efficacy of BodyFX, a noninvasive radiofrequency (RF) device, in reducing subcutaneous fat volume and improving body contour. Traditional fat reduction methods often involve invasive procedures; this study aims to quantify fat reduction achieved through BodyFX treatments.
Conclusion
The study concludes that BodyFX is an effective noninvasive treatment for reducing subcutaneous fat and improving body contour. Participants experienced significant reductions in fat thickness and volume, with high levels of satisfaction and no reported adverse effects. These findings support the use of BodyFX as a safe and effective alternative to invasive fat reduction procedures.
TOPICS COVERED
- Evaluation of BodyFX for noninvasive fat reduction and body contouring
- Prospective study involving 20 female participants
- Use of high-resolution ultrasound and 3D imaging to measure fat thickness and volume
- Treatment protocol consisting of weekly sessions over a 12-week period
Assessment of safety, patient satisfaction, and clinical outcomes
